1What is the best time of year to schedule HVAC maintenance in Hammond, NY?

For Hammond's cold climate, the ideal time is late summer/early fall for heating systems and early spring for cooling systems. This ensures your furnace is ready for the harsh North Country winters and your AC is prepped for occasional summer heatwaves. Scheduling during these shoulder seasons is easier and may prevent emergency service calls during peak demand.

2Are there specific local regulations or incentives for HVAC upgrades in St. Lawrence County?

Yes, Hammond homeowners should be aware of New York State's building codes, which include specific energy efficiency requirements for new HVAC installations. Additionally, you may qualify for state and federal tax credits or rebates through NYSERDA for installing high-efficiency heat pumps or geothermal systems, which are excellent for our climate and can significantly reduce heating costs.

3Why is my heat pump struggling to heat my home efficiently during the coldest weeks in Hammond?

This is a common concern due to our extreme winter temperatures, where it can routinely drop below 20°F. Standard air-source heat pumps lose efficiency in deep cold, often requiring a supplemental heat source like a gas furnace or electric resistance coils (the "emergency heat" setting). For a primary solution, consider a cold-climate heat pump specifically rated for low temperatures or a dual-fuel system.

5What are the most important factors affecting the cost of a new furnace installation in my Hammond home?

The primary factors are the unit's efficiency rating (AFUE), the size (tonnage) needed for your home's square footage and insulation level, and the complexity of the installation, especially with older ductwork. Given our long heating season, investing in a higher-efficiency model (90% AFUE or above) often provides the best long-term value through lower fuel bills, despite a higher upfront cost.
